Connection Diagram - EVAP System

Fig 1: Identifying Connection Diagram Of EVAP System

  1. Breather Line
    • from EVAP canister to EVAP Canister Purge Regulator Valve 1 -N80-
  2. Fuel Tank
  3. Vent Line
    • from fuel tank to EVAP canister
  4. Air Filter
    • For the leak detection system
    • Market-specific
  5. EVAP Canister
  6. Vent Line
    • To air filter
  7. Breather Line
    • To EVAP Canister Purge Regulator Valve 1 -N80-
  8. Fuel Tank Leak Detection Control Module -J909-
    • With integrated Fuel Tank Pressure Sensor -G400-
    • Country specific NAR
    • Installed location: on the left side at the back of the underbody under the cover
    • Checking in Guided Functions  see Vehicle Diagnostic Tester
    • Removing and installing, refer to LEAK DETECTION PUMP, REMOVING AND INSTALLING .
  9. EVAP Canister Purge Regulator Valve 1 -N80-
  10. Check Valve
